Title: Le Saint Edit. étude de littérature chinoise préparée par A. Théophile Piry, du Service des Douanes Maritimes de Chine. Shanghai, Bureau des Statistiques, Inspectorat Général des Douanes, 1879.
Description: . 4to. Pp. xx, 317, (3) + one folding table "Caracteres du Saint Edit" (loose). Publisher's blue full calico on boards, blindstamped decorated frames, gilt-stamped title in Chinese characters on upper cover. A French edition of the revised version of the "Sacred Edict" (Sheng-yü kuang-hsün), a popular text book for the improvement of manners in China. It contains 16 moral maxims which can be regarded as the basic laws of China during the Ch'ing dynasty. Originally written by the Kang-hsi emperor and later on extended by his successor the Yung-cheng emperor. Cordier BS 1427.
